"Lynch Bages 2006 is the best young Lynch I have ever tasted and I'm certain
this will go down in this great Chateaux's history, as one of their finest
ever. Its a true marvel; Dark viscous purple/black in colour with an elating
nose of vibrant blackcurrants and vanilla/double cream.On the palate it has the
texture and weight of olive oil,so hedonistically concentrated but with such
rich ripe black fruits it takes your breath away. The core and finish is so
cool,defined and sumptuous that I really cant find a single quality it lacks. A
staggering bottle of wine that will probably be like an 1982 ie delicious all
through its life."
(Simon Staples, BBR Fine Wine Director)
